1 // { dg-do run }
2 // { dg-require-weak "" }
3 // On darwin, we use attr-weakref-1-darwin.c.
4 // This test requires support for undefined weak symbols. This support
5 // is not available on hppa*-*-hpux*. The test is skipped rather than
6 // xfailed to suppress the warning that would otherwise arise.
7 // { dg-skip-if "" { "*-*-darwin*" "hppa*-*-hpux*" "*-*-aix*" } "*" { "" } }
8 // For kernel modules and static RTPs, the loader treats undefined weak
9 // symbols in the same way as undefined strong symbols. The test
10 // therefore fails to load, so skip it.
11 // { dg-skip-if "" { "*-*-vxworks*" && nonpic } "*" { "-non-static" } }
12 // { dg-options "-O2" }
13 // { dg-additional-sources "attr-weakref-1a.c" }

18 // Torture test for weakrefs. The first letter of an identifier
19 // indicates whether/how it is defined; the second letter indicates
20 // whether it is part of a variable or function test; the number that
21 // follows is a test counter, and a letter that may follow enables
22 // multiple identifiers within the same test (e.g., multiple weakrefs
23 // or pointers to the same identifier).
25 // Identifiers starting with W are weakrefs; those with p are
26 // pointers; those with g are global definitions; those with l are
27 // local definitions; those with w are expected to be weak undefined
28 // in the symbol table; those with u are expected to be marked as
29 // non-weak undefined in the symbol table.
